She was born with the first snowflakes being carried through the cracks of the cottage door by the howling wind. The midwife looked over the child carefully while wrapping the child in the wool cloth. The midwife found what she was looking for on the bottom of the child’s foot.

“She’s so beautiful.” She told the mother who was finally resting in the bed.

“So much pain for such a little bundle.” The mother said with a sigh.

With the child bundled, the midwife gave her to the mother who began to nurse the infant. The midwife watched the mother for a few moments to see the baby was nursing and sat in the rocking chair to keep warm by the raging fire. Her plan came together as she rocked and watched the mother doating over the child.

The child sleeping in the cradle, and the mother sound asleep in her bed, the midwife silently slipped a dagger from her bag. Sneaking up to the side of the bed she waited for the mother to exhale her final snore. A quick and heavy swipe of the dagger across the throat allowed blood to flow gushingly. The mother’s eyes flew open, and her mouth worked as she tried to draw a breath, but nothing came. She stumbled from the bed groping for the murderer. The midwife backed away from the scene and waited silently for death to claim the mother. As her body fell, the mother reached out for the child and her fingers brushed the cradle which gently rocked never waking the baby. The midwife left the cottage with the baby wrapped protected against the cold as the shadows of clouds crossed over the moon bound for the castle of the Queen.

Standing in the vast stone room, the cold penetrating her body, she began to shake. Hearing the clicking of heels announcing the arrival of the Queen, the midwife peered in the dark trying to find where the sound was coming from. With a snap of fingers, the torches lining the room came to life. The midwife cowered as she saw the queen sitting on her royal throne.

“Your majesty, I beg your pardon for arriving so late. I have the child.” The midwife quickly explained.

“She has the mark?” The icy voice pierced the silence.

“Yes, on her foot.” The midwife said.

“Bring her forth.” The Queen demanded.

The midwife carried the child forward, uncovered the foot and held it up for the Queen to examine the mark. The Queen shrank back upon seeing the mark on the foot of the child that was foretold to bring about the end of the Queen. Seeing the reaction of the Queen, the midwife bundled the child tightly in the cloth and cowered low waiting for the wrath of the Queen.

“You will remain here and raise the child.” The Queen pronounced with a quiver in her voice. “Is the mother of the child dead?”

“Yes, your majesty.” The midwife said.

The Queen stood from the throne and clapped her hands together. It sounded like thunder as the sound bounced from stone to stone. The floor began to shake as a single flame from every torch jumped onto the stone floor and began dancing. With another clap of the Queen’s hands the flames raged into life until a shadow appeared in the circle of dancing flames. When the fire died away, left standing there was a grotesque creature unlike anything the midwife had ever imagined could exist.

“You can never leave the castle. This creature will give you everything you need for yourself and the child. Beware, this creature never sleeps, nor will it allow you to leave. Take them to the room.” The Queen commanded. The creature shambled towards the doorway and the midwife followed it.

For the next twenty-three years the midwife cared for the child, living in the dank dungeon surrounded only by the torch and firelight. The child grew into a beautiful woman with flowing black hair and alabaster skin from living in the dark. The midwife came to love the child and tried many times to fool the creature to escape from the castle, but all her plans failed. The midwife knew the day was coming when the Queen would kill the child.

One day the Queen stood in front of the magic mirror and said her spell to call the spirit in the mirror to come forward.

“Spirit in the mirror, tell me when the child is to be destroyed.” The Queen asked.

“The child, my Queen, should be destroyed today, to ensure you will rule all the land forever more.” The mirror intoned.

“It shall be done.” The Queen stated. She said her spell and the mirror went dark as the spirit went back to the netherworld.

Walking away the Queen summoned the creature and gave it orders to take the child to the forest, kill her, and bring back her heart for proof of death. The creature bowed to the Queen and shambled back to the room to get the child. Opening the door, the creature motioned to the child to come out. The midwife fearing this was the time the child would be killed, rushed at the creature and with one powerful blow knocked the midwife to the ground where she laid not able to stop the creature taking the child away from her. The child left the room, and the door was closed and locked. The creature motioned to the child to follow, obeying, they began walking, leaving the castle behind and made their journey towards the forest.

Coming to a clearing in the middle of the forest the creature stopped and prepared to kill the child.

“Bog, why are we stopping?” The child asked.

Looking at the child the creature couldn’t look into her eyes. The child didn’t know that the creature came to love the child as the midwife loved her as it watched her grow over the years. It came to love hearing the child laugh and giggle and she never feared it no matter how grotesque it looked. It took the dagger that killed her mother from its cloak and raised it above it’s head. Seeing the dagger, the child began to cry. Hearing her weeping, it lowered the dagger letting it fall from its hand to the ground. It moaned and began flailing its arms at the child motioning for the child to run away. Seizing her chance, the child ran leaving the creature behind.

She ran until darkness fell and finally came to a cottage. Looking into the windows she saw it empty. She tried the latch and the door opened. Walking in the cottage she closed the door behind her and began to look around. She started a fire in the fireplace as the midwife had taught her. She looked around and found some fruit on the table and ate until she was full. She became sleepy and walked to the other room and found seven small beds. She laid down across the four beds and fell asleep.

A violent sneeze broke the silence and startled the girl awake. Looking around she saw seven pairs of eyes looking at her.

“Do not be afraid.” One set of eyes said.

“Yes, please do not be afraid." The other voices said in unison.

“Who are you?” She asked.

“We are the one’s who dwell within.” One voice said.

With lamps being lit she was able to count seven little men looking at her. They were very short, and harmless looking.

“My name is Doc. I’m in charge.” Doc said.

“My name is Sneezy, and this is Dopy.” Sneezy said introducing himself and the man next to him.

“My name is Happy, the one hiding behind me is Bashful, and the one standing in the corner over there is Grumpy.”

“What cute little men!” She said clapping her hands.

“Shows what she knows, we are dwarves!” Grumpy shouted.

“Please do not make me leave. The Queen will be after me. Please let me stay. Please.” She begged.

The dwarves gathered around each other and whispered to each other about her fate. Doc finally turned to face her and said, “We will allow you to stay for as long as you wish.” Seeing her overjoyed they had a feast and made merry that night.

The days and the nights passed for a long time. She made their lives easier by cooking for them and cleaning during the days and she told them stories at night. They all lived happily believing that the Queen would never find them.

One night when the delicious dinner was finished, and everyone was sleeping, Doc was awakened by noise outside the cottage. He quietly woke everyone to investigate the noise. Armed with clubs they headed towards the door while the girl was to remain in her bed. Something rattled the latch on the cottage door. They gathered their strength ready to fight when the door was kicked in and tall men covered in black armor rushed in the room and the girl began screaming and all the lamps went out.

Officer Repot

Reporting office: Sgt. Frank Williams Date: 5/18/2020 Report type: Potential Missing person Located/Break-In/Mass Arrest of Child Traffickers

Officer’s Narrative: Unknown female found in an occupied housing area. Arrived on scene after a call from owners return home from being out of the country for suspected squatters/break-in. Female doesn’t have any identification, doesn’t know where she lives, doesn’t know who her parents are. Doesn’t appear to be under the influence of drugs or alcohol. Her clothing is disheveled and ill fitting for the current weather conditions. When asked for her name all she will say is “My name is Snow White.”

Disposition of Report: It is recommended that the girl be transferred by ambulance to St. Marks hospital for both wellness check and mental exam.

Doctor Russell

Daily Report for patient # 75543255A

Report/Interview # 2232

Report Date: 02/25/2023

Patient Name: Sara Lydell

Patient Date of birth: 12/13/1997

*IMPORTANT DETAILS*: Name Patient will respond to is Snow White

Doctor’s Narrative: Patient’s condition remains stable; she responds well to medication with limited side effects. Patient continues to thrive well while institutionalized. Patient eats well during meals and has a proper BMI (Body Mass Index). Patient attends all therapy sessions with her group and one-on-one sessions. However, after all progress, the patient is still at a loss with reality. She still has no grasp of her real name (Sara Lydell identity established by court and through the process of finger printing from birth records) nor will she respond to any name other than Snow White.

Patient while suffering from PTSD (Post Traumatic Stress Disorder) from living as a kidnapped child in a house of horrors with other kidnapped children. Following the narrative that Ms. Lydell tells of her past living circumstances, mimics the Snow-White tale that was told to her from an older child.

The “Evil Queen” Jenna (last name redacted) was the “house mother” who kept all the children in the house who were later falsely adopted or sold at an underground black-market auction. Those that were not adopted as children would later be sold into sex slavery or murdered (as supported by supplemental police reports and court testimony).

The “Midwife” Carol (last name redacted) was a woman who portrayed herself as a licensed Neo-Natal Nurse to gain access to the hospital when the pregnant women who was under surveillance by the group would be rushed to the hospital to give birth. Carol would gain admittance to the newborn babies and kidnap the healthy child from the hospital and take the child to the “house mother.” Carol “marks” the child by cutting the bottom of the child’s foot for identification for the group and it is assumed to ensure that later identification using birth records will be made impossible should the child escape.

The creature(s) known as “Bog” (AKA BOSS) were sentinel guards who were placed outside the door where the children were stored. The children were under 24-hour guard to ensure there were no escapes. To ensure the children would make no connections to the guards, the guards wore Halloween masks that were of different monster creatures. The children were to call the guards “BOSS” some smaller children would say “Bog.”

The day of Sara’s escape, many children were sick and the bathroom facilities normally used for the children were taxed and the guard allowed Sara to leave confinement to use an upstairs bathroom and Sara saw and overheard the “The Queen” speaking on a cellphone via video call to an unknown male (still unidentified) who relayed to the “The Queen” Sara had to be destroyed due to her being a drain on resources and no interest that would benefit the group. It was then Sara overheard she would be killed. For reasons unknown the guard who was tasked with killing Sara in a vacant lot where other children (deceased) have been recovered, allowed her to escape.

Sara made her way to an occupied house about 2 miles away from her escape location, broke in and lived in the house of Mr. and Mrs. Knott for two weeks while they were out of the country. Upon the couple returning home, seeing the empty house appeared to be occupied, the Knott’s called the police to report a break in. The police apprehended Sara and following a short investigation and finding the state of Sara and her lack coherency she was later transported to St. Marks hospital and committed to the Mental health ward.

The ”Seven Dwarves” are a part of Sara’s personality based on her confinement, maltreatment, and suffering from PTSD, her personality has fractured, and she has created these personalities to help her cope with her circumstances and also to keep herself company while she was alone after being around other children and young adults for her entire life.

Doctor’s Recommendations: Sara is to remain on current medication regimen, current group therapy sessions, and follow up one on one therapy sessions. Sara is to remain in the custody of St. Mark’s mental health ward until she is fully recovered. Visitation with her birth parents will remain on a twice-a-month basis until sufficient improvement has been made by Sara to warrant more frequency.
